About This Book
Brooke's robots zoom through the streets, sucking up everything in sight! She barely dodges a runaway vacuum as it spins out of control, threatening to wreck the whole neighborhood. Can she stop her inventions before they cause even more chaos?

Quick Assessment
This middle-grade fiction follows Brooke, a young inventor who creates autonomous vacuum-cleaning robots that start causing unintended trouble in her community. The story highlights themes of creativity, responsibility, and problem-solving, suitable for readers aged 9-12. It contains light action and mild peril but no intense content.
